ArtStation is Joining the Epic Games Family

Dear friends,

Today, we’re thrilled to announce that ArtStation is joining the Epic Games family. Together, we’ll accelerate the development and growth of the creator community worldwide. This partnership underscores both Epic’s and ArtStation’s mission to empower creators with the tools and platforms to thrive. You can read the announcement at the Epic Games Newsroom.

ArtStation and Epic Games have shared a great relationship since we burst onto the scene in 2014. The Unreal Engine team has been incredibly supportive of our efforts and initiatives. Last year, at the initial height of the pandemic, Epic committed to supporting us with a Megagrant, which helped immensely during an uncertain period. Through our collaboration, we witnessed Epic’s deep respect for the ArtStation community and that we shared the same mission to empower creators. It became clear that by joining forces, we would have a much bigger impact. 

ArtStation will remain an independently branded platform owned by Epic Games and will continue its mission to empower creators to thrive. You can still use the platform as you do today, and we will continue to be open to all creators across verticals, both 2D and 3D alike – including those that don’t use Unreal Engine. We’ll be actively hiring and growing the ArtStation team. We’re committed to improving the platform and now as a part of Epic, we’ll be able to do much more.

Earn more on the ArtStation Marketplace

As of today, we’re massively increasing the earning potential of sellers on the ArtStation Marketplace. We’re dropping our standard fees from 30% to only 12%. For Pro members, the fee reduces from 20% to 8% and 5% for self-promoted sales. See our Earnings Calculator for more details on the new ArtStation Marketplace fees.

ArtStation Learning is free for the rest of 2021

We’re also making ArtStation Learning free to all members for the remainder of 2021. ArtStation Learning is our streaming video service for artists. It features unlimited access to an ever-growing content library from industry professionals. Artists can expand their skills in a wide range of art topics and learn at their own pace. Will you be updating ArtStation’s policies? 

We’ve updated the ArtStation Terms of Service and Privacy Policy, which you will be asked to review and agree to when you log into your ArtStation account. The language is pretty similar to what you’re already familiar with. But since we are now a part of Epic Games, these terms and policy are an agreement with Epic, while before you were in an agreement with Ballistiq Digital Inc, which owned ArtStation before we joined Epic.
